In an effort to share information on the 2006 Census of Population with all New Brunswickers, the Department of Finance, in collaboration with Statistics Canada, created this site dedicated primarily to New Brunswick results.

On this page, you will find answers to your questions about the demographic, economic and social fabric of New Brunswick’s population.
